In order for mold to form, it needs a steady, strong source of moisture and temperature to grow and flourish. Waterproofing your basement WOn't fully protect, or eliminate the risk of mold and mildew, since the pipes in you basement can still drip or leak and result in mold. When the drips or leaks are found and repaired quickly, you're greatly reducing the danger of mold and mildew.

Basement Waterproofing more often than not involves some form of concrete or foundation repair. The drain tile is a system that is constructed on the outside wall of your foundation and redirects water through a ground drainage system away from the basement walls. There are many potential causes of water damage to your basement. The most common cause is the possibility of having land that's a flat or negative slope. This will cause water to pool and gather against your foundation. Another possibility is that the builder of your house did not properly waterproof your foundation.

When it comes to basement waterproofing stuff, you should determine what type of waterproofing system you are going to use. French drains, also referred to as land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ains comprise a system made of gravel, ditches, and conduit that ask groundwater into the conduit and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Soil and routes can clog such a drainage system.
